Leadership
CCI Services’ Board of Directors are a dedicated team of professionals who volunteer their time to drive the success of the organisation. Board members are selected for their industry knowledge, unique skill sets, and desire to support the achievements of Australia’s vitally important not for profit sector.
Steven brings over 30 years of leadership experience in healthcare and human services across Australia and internationally. He has successfully led organisations through major growth phases, including more than 20 acquisitions, expanding operations throughout Australia and New Zealand. His expertise spans executive leadership, corporate governance, and M&A strategy. With an MBA, a nursing background, and executive education from Harvard Business School, Steven serves as a board member and advisor to healthcare, aged care, community service, and not-for-profit organisations. He is a trusted leader and mentor, committed to driving organisational success and advancing quality care in the community.
Emily brings extensive experience in governance, compliance, and strategic leadership across the health and community services sector. She has guided organisations through complex regulatory environments and supported initiatives that strengthen organisational integrity and performance. Her expertise spans corporate governance, risk management, and executive leadership. With a Bachelor of Laws and Legal Practice, a Practising Certificate as a Barrister and Solicitor in South Australia, and a Master of Business Administration, Emily is also a Graduate Member of the Australian Institute of Company Directors and an alumna of the Governor’s Leadership Foundation Course. She is committed to driving organisational excellence and ethical leadership in the community.
